Jazz Tangcay Artisans Editor The detail in costume design can define a character — especially for Amazon Prime’s epic “The Lord of the Rings: The Rings of Power” and its retro “Daisy Jones & the Six.” Whether creating costumes for sea guards and Harfoots, “LOTR” costume designer Kate Hawley created over 2,000 outfits for the series. Hawley used blue rather extensively in stones and costumes to reflect the regal presence of Morfydd Clark’s elf, Galadriel, and Cynthia Addai-Robinson’s Míriel, Queen-Regent of Númenor. She created garments for the nomadic Harfoots that would shield them at night. The idea was that, like wild animals, they avoid detection from perceived enemies by just sitting still and blending into their environment.
While she drew on author J.R.R. Tolkien’s books for inspiration, Hawley also looked at 1920s Expressionist films and Greek armor and statues. The latter influenced dwarf helmets, which come complete with side shields for their beards. “Daisy Jones & the Six” costume designer Denise Wingate needed her looks to be seeped in the 1970s. She spent months at flea markets and vintage stores to build the rock-inspired look for Daisy (Riley Keough). Wingate even worked with Love Melody, a designer who worked with Keough’s grandfather, Elvis Presley, on one coat thanks to a tip from Levi’s during her search for vintage wear. “They said I should call this woman who did really cool clothing from the ’70s, and that she was the real deal,” Wingate says. “She asked me ‘Who’s in your show?’ and I said, ‘Riley Keough.’ She goes, ‘Oh, I made jumpsuits for Elvis.’ Isn’t that crazy?” Melody made two coats that Keough wears as Daisy: a rust-colored leather piece and a denim and leather patchwork coat. Jazz Tangcay Artisans Editor RuPaul’s go-to costume designer Zaldy Goco, who goes by Zaldy, has worked with the “Drag Race” superstar for over a decade and is no stranger to designing Ru’s show-stopping outfits. For RuPaul’s Season 15 finale look, Zaldy — whose trust with RuPaul runs so deep, they don’t even discuss finale looks prior to fittings — tells Variety he wanted it to feel “goddess-like and for Ru to float in.” Zaldy knew he wanted a unique color, so the three-time Emmy winner settled on a citrine and chartreuse combination that screamed springtime. For some extra sparkle, he added metallic fringe to the dress from Swiss fabric manufacturer Jakob Schlaepfer.

Michael Schneider Variety Editor at Large We’ve all made the “Cop Rock” jokes. The Steven Bochco musical drama, which premiered in fall 1990, was a big swing: marrying original music with procedural storytelling. It was a colossal flop that we still talk about three decades later, and a reminder that musicals are hard. Music has been a part of the TV landscape going back to the 1950s and shows like “Your Hit Parade.” But few series have successfully integrated regular music performances into their storytelling: “The Monkees” and “The Partridge Family” worked in the 1960s and ’70s. “Fame” did it in the early ’80s. And then “Cop Rock” scared people off the concept.

Ben Croll The walls of Barcelona’s international convention center might soon rattle once the 4,000 European exhibitors, suppliers and service providers in town for the CineEurope trade show breathe out a collective sigh of relief. At the root of such succor are Europe’s more than encouraging box-office admissions, which saw a marked uptick in late 2022 and have continued to rise into the new year. “I think this edition will be very much about celebrating because 2022 was a much better year than 2021,” says Laura Houlgatte, CEO of the Intl. Union of Cinemas (UNIC), which tends to the needs of cinema trade associations and exhibitors across the old continent. “[What’s more] the numbers for the first quarter of 2023 have left everyone in a very good mood.”

Outlanderstar Caitríona Balfe has shared some very exciting news about the upcoming eighth and final season of the historical drama. Speaking at the 2023 Austin Television Festival over the weekend, the actress revealed that she will be stepping behind the camera to direct an episode of the new season. On how she feels about taking on the new role, she said: "Very excited…very terrified!"In prep, I've been doing a little bit of second unit stuff already.

Michael Schneider Variety Editor at Large It’s still unbelievable to think that Riley Keough didn’t have any real singing experience before starring in Amazon Prime Video’s “Daisy Jones & the Six.” Actually, most of the cast didn’t — which makes the tremendous sound of the band all the more impressive. “Daisy Jones & the Six” did what few other shows have done (perhaps “The Monkees” being the other most notable): turned a group of actors playing characters in a band… into an actual band. But back to Keough for a second. Yeah, every story about her and “Daisy Jones” says the same thing: What? She hadn’t sang before? But she’s ROCK ROYALTY. (Granddaughter of Elvis Presley, c’mon, you know the drill by now.) Some might argue it’s in the genes, but that’s just a fraction of it. Don’t sell Keough short. It was hard work and talent. And a lot more hard work. Keough and the “Daisy Jones & the Six” cast also had a bit of weird timing on their side too, as COVID-related production delays forced them to keep practicing. And after all that rehearsal time, they got good. Real good.
